**Changed defaults: export retries**

Welcome aboard! Quick one: Ledgerfox exports used to fail silently and stay failed. As of this release, failed exports retry automatically with exponential backoff, capped at five attempts, and then land in a dead-letter queue you can replay. No action needed for existing jobs. The new retry behavior is governed by these defaults.

service settings:
[casax]
port = 6379
team = rusir
host = casax.zemvarhq.corp
region = outer-4
access_code = ac_9808ce
timeout_ms = 1500

Handover — from M. Strale to P. Venn

Board-facing item: the Caldmere warehouse write-down. Obsolete Q-line stock valued down 38%; auditors accept the methodology. Provision booked this quarter. Remaining task: dispose of residual units via the Torbridge outlet channel by year end. Paperwork is in the shared drawer. One sensitive point follows for your eyes only.

board note of kageg-bahof: The renewal with Holwynax Holdings closes at $2 million a year, 5 percent below the last contract. Project Ulaath slips by two quarters because of the supplier delay.

- [ ] **Step 7: Breaker override escrow.** After sealing the signing keys for the Tallgrove upstream API circuit breaker, confirm the support team can force the breaker open during a full outage. The override bundle lives in the sealed escrow drawer and is useless without its unlock phrase. Two ceremony witnesses must initial this step before proceeding. The escrow bundle is decrypted with the recovery passphrase that follows.

vault phrase of kahip-kahop = holath-quenmir

14:22 — Offline sync regression confirmed (Terrapath field-survey app)

At 14:22 the on-call engineer reproduced the data-loss path: surveys saved while offline were marked synced once connectivity returned, even when the upload was rejected. The queue flush skipped the server acknowledgement check introduced in the previous sprint. Release manager note: the fix must ship before the coastal survey season. The offending build is identified by the token recorded below.

session token of kawif-fawig = htk31_f3f599be2b1a34affb1efa8d0feccf8

Welcome to the Fennimore Prototype Workshop. Contractors must wear safety glasses past the yellow line and check in with the floor lead on arrival. Tools stay on the benches; nothing leaves the room without a sign-out slip. To enter the workshop during your engagement, use the contractor door code listed below.

badge for fafop-fajof: bdg-Z-47